Identification and characterization of a Streptomyces sp. isolate exhibiting activity against multidrug-resistant coagulase-negative Staphylococci

Abstract: The resistance of 220 coagulase-negative Staphylococci (CNS) (associated with animal disease) to 13 antibiotics were determined using the disk diffusion method. 35.9% of multidrug-resistant coagulase-negative Staphylococci (MR-CNS) exhibited resistance to five or more than five antibiotics; all of these bacteria were resistant to methicillin too. The new Streptomyces sp. ABRIINW111 was isolated from the Zagros Mountains Hamadan, Iran. The 16S rDNA sequence of the isolate indicated that it has 98% similarity to… Show more

“…Antibiotics such as Erythromycin, Streptomycin, Tetracycline and a variety of essential extensively-used drugs can be isolated from the Streptomyces species [13]. Secondary metabolites are organic compounds that are not directly associated with the normal growth, development or propagation of a microorganism, unlike primary metabolites that are essential for the growth of microorganisms.…”
